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

A hose coupling guard including a fixture configured to connect to a hose coupling having a release mechanism, and a cover movably connected to the fixture to be movable between a first position and a second position. The cover includes a shield configured to enclose the release mechanism when the cover is in the first position, and to expose the release mechanism when the cover is in the second position. A display surface may be located on the shield and configured to be oriented to face a location from which an operator can operate the release mechanism.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

The invention claimed is: 1. A hose coupling guard comprising: a fixture configured to connect to a hose coupling having a release mechanism; and a cover movably connected to the fixture to be movable between a first position and a second position, the cover comprising a shield configured to enclose the release mechanism when the cover is in the first position, and to expose the release mechanism when the cover is in the second position, a travel stop to prevent said cover from moving past the second position, said travel stop maintaining a center of gravity of said cover on a first side of a movable connection joining said cover to the fixture throughout movement of said cover between the first position and the second position such that gravitational force applied to the center of gravity of said cover causes said cover to move to the first position from the second position, wherein the fixture comprises a crossbeam configured to span a side of the hose coupling and a U-bolt configured to surround an opposite side of the hose coupling and be secured to the crossbeam, and wherein a return spring operatively connected between the cover and the fixture and configured to bias the cover to the first position. 2. The hose coupling guard of claim 1 , where in the cover further comprises a display surface on the shield and configured to be oriented to face a location from which an operator can operate the release mechanism. 3. The hose coupling guard of claim 2 , wherein the display surface is movably mounted to the shield. 4. The hose coupling guard of claim 2 , wherein the display surface comprises a flat panel depicting a warning message. 5. The hose coupling guard of claim 1 , wherein the cover is pivotally connected to the fixture by a hinge. 6. The hose coupling guard of claim 1 , wherein the cover further comprises at least one handle. 7. The hose coupling guard of claim 6 wherein the at least one handle comprises a first handle extending laterally in a first direction from a longitudinal axis of the hose coupling, and a second handle extending laterally in a second direction from the longitudinal axis of the hose coupling. 8. The hose coupling guard of claim 7 , wherein the release mechanism comprises a first lever located on a first lateral side of the longitudinal axis of the hose coupling, and a second lever located on a second lateral side of the longitudinal axis of the house coupling, and, when the cover is in the first position, the first handle is located adjacent the first lever, and the second handle is located adjacent the second lever. 9. The hose coupling guard of claim 1 , wherein the shield comprises a semi-cylindrical panel. 10. The hose coupling guard of claim 1 , wherein the shield comprises a solid enclosure. 11. The hose coupling guard of claim 1 , wherein the release mechanism is movable along a travel path from an engaged position to a disengaged position, and at least a portion of the shield is located in the travel path when the cover is in the first position. 12. The hose coupling guard of claim 1 , wherein the release mechanism comprises a first lever located on a first lateral side of a longitudinal axis of the hose coupling, and a second lever located on a second lateral side of the longitudinal axis of the hose coupling, and the shield is dimensioned to prevent the first lever and the second lever from moving to a respective disengaged position when the cover is in the first position.
